LOS ANGELES - The on-off-on-again relationship between Nicole Richie and her ex-fiance, Adam Goldstein, is off again.

“We are confirming that we have amicably separated,” the pair said in a statement released Monday by Richie’s publicist, Cindy Guagenti. They did not provide any details.

Richie, 24, and Goldstein, a professional club DJ who goes by the name DJ AM, called off their nine-month engagement in December.

They were spotted together in recent months, and Richie confirmed they were dating in an interview for the June issue of Vanity Fair.

Richie, the daughter of R&B crooner Lionel Richie, co-stars with ex-friend Paris Hilton in “The Simple Life.”

The reality show moved to E! Entertainment Television after Fox declined to air a fourth season. A new format allows the feuding friends to have nothing to do with each other.
